    First, currently it would be former WWE Superstar Jeff Hardy as the "loser leave town" thing was done as he wanted to take time off and did not sign a new contract.
    He was bailed out within a few hours by "his brother" according the sheriff's dept within a few hours.
    None of this is surprising since Jeff already had two strikes for failed drug tests and it was drug use that led to WWE originally letting him go.
